Breakdown of Costs for Obtaining a Driver's License in Bavaria

The overall cost of acquiring a motorist's license in Bavaria can be divided into numerous parts. Below is a breakdown of the common expenses involved:

ExpenseCost (Approximate)
Application FeeEUR40 - EUR80
Vision TestEUR6 - EUR10
Emergency Treatment CourseEUR30 - EUR50
Theoretical Test FeeEUR20 - EUR30
Driving Lessons (per lesson)EUR50 - EUR100
Practical Test FeeEUR150 - EUR250
Extra Costs (e.g., for driving instructor charges)EUR50 - EUR150
Total Estimated CostsEUR600 - EUR1,500

Application Fee

The application cost is usually paid at the regional chauffeur's license authority when submitting your application. This charge covers processing your application and is a necessary expenditure.

Vision and Health Tests

Before getting a motorist's license, candidates need to pass both a vision and health test. The costs normally range from EUR6 to EUR10 for the vision test, while health-related concerns may need additional documents that can sustain additional charges.

Emergency Treatment Course

An emergency treatment course is required for all brand-new motorists. The expense for this varies from EUR30 to EUR50, depending on the organization offering the course.

Theoretical Test Fee

The theoretical test, which covers the rules of the road and driving guidelines, expenses in between EUR20 and EUR30. Passing this test is necessary before moving on to practical driving lessons.

Driving Lessons

Practical driving lessons are a significant expense when using for a chauffeur's license. The expense ranges from EUR50 to EUR100 per lesson, and candidates normally need about 10 to 20 lessons before taking the dry run.

Dry Run Fee

After completing the required lessons, candidates must pay a fee of around EUR150 to EUR250 to take the practical driving test. This fee can differ depending upon the screening location and inspectors' rates.

Extra Costs

Extra expenses might occur depending upon the specific circumstances of the candidate. This may consist of charges for products (like research study handbooks) or time spent with a driving instructor for additional lessons.

Overall Estimated Costs

As indicated, the total estimated expenses for getting a chauffeur's license in Bavaria can vary from EUR600 to EUR1,500. The final amount depends upon various aspects, including the classification of license looked for, the number of driving lessons required, and individual situations.

Crucial Considerations

When budgeting for a chauffeur's license, applicants ought to consider the following:

  • Different Categories: Costs can increase considerably for more complicated licenses, such as those for buses (Class D) or heavy trucks (Class C).
  • Personal Learning Speed: Individuals who find out much faster might spend less on driving lessons.
  • Location: Costs may differ depending on the city or municipality within Bavaria.
